NECIC 2006 |
|
|
|
|
The first NECIC ( National Early Childhood Intervention
Conference ) carried the theme "Parents, Practitioners and Policy Makers in
Positive Partnership" and was held in Penang from 18th
to 20th November 2006. The conference’s
secretariat was Asia Community Service (Penang) with more
than twenty one non-government and not-for-profit
organisations around Malaysia and was in collaboration with
UNICEF, the Department of Social Welfare, Ministry of Women,
Family and Social Development, the Special Education
Department, Ministry of Education and the Division of Family
Health Development, Ministry of Health. The Guest of Honour
was YABhg. Datin Paduka Seri Rosmah Mansor, wife of YAB
Deputy Prime Minister of Malaysia.
It was attended by more than three hundred and fifty local
participants, thirty local speakers and nine facilitators
from Australia, United Kingdom and Singapore. They presented
a total of forty five papers. Among others, the topics
covered included models and approaches in early childhood
intervention; screening, early detection and management;
meeting educational needs and how parents can take the lead.
A Memorandum of Early Childhood Intervention setting out the
objectives and future directions for early childhood
intervention services in Malaysia was adopted by the
delegates and was presented to their Guest of Honour, YABhg.
Datin Paduka Seri Rosmah Mansor. |

NECIC 2008 |
|
|
|
|
The second
NECIC is being held in Kota Kinabalu, Sabah from
19th to 22nd November 2008.
This includes two pre conference workshops. Persatuan
C.H.I.L.D. Sabah is Secretariat for this event.
The theme
for NECIC 2008 is “ Partners in Practice for Early
Therapeutic Intervention ”. With this theme,
Persatuan C.H.I.L.D. Sabah, together with more than
twenty four non-profit / not-for-profit organisations around
Malaysia, will work together to realise this event. NECIC
2008 is supported by agencies such as Ministry of Women,
Family and Social Development Malaysia, Department of Social
Welfare Malaysia, UNICEF, Ministry of Health, Ministry of
Community Development and Consumer Affairs Sabah and
Progressive Education Foundation Sabah. These agencies will
work together towards a successful and favourable conference
that hopes to create a better understanding of Early
Childhood Intervention.
At the end of the conference it is hoped that a monitoring
group will be set up to monitor the implementation and
effectiveness of various facilities of Early Childhood
Intervention Services in Malaysia. |
